Disrupt Talent are proud to be recruiting on behalf of a wonderful client in the live events and immersive experiences business as they expand their operations into the US. This is a brilliant opportunity for an energetic, hands‑on Event Operations professional who is excited by a step up and the chance to play a key part in scaling delivery in a new market.

The business is currently delivering around 4 shows per weekend, with plans to build this significantly over the next couple of years to mirror their UK operation. You will be joining at an exciting stage of growth, taking ownership of day‑to‑day event operations, leading weekend delivery teams, and ensuring every guest experience is delivered to the highest possible standard.

Location

This role is based in Boston, Massachusetts, with candidates ideally located in Arlington or Westborough, or within a wider commutable area if you are happy to travel.

Hybrid working applies, with 3 days in the office and 2 working from home, alongside on‑site presence at shows as required.

Reporting into

Head of Regional Event Operations (Boston)

The Role

This is a role for someone who thrives in a fast‑paced environment, enjoys problem solving, and takes pride in delivering exceptional event experiences. You will be responsible for the day‑to‑day operations of multiple immersive events, ensuring teams are trained, processes are followed, and everything runs smoothly from set‑up through to close.

In the early stage of the operation, you will need to be on site at shows regularly until you have a strong understanding of the delivery model and are confident the weekend teams are fully trained and operating to standard.

Mon - Friday, (with a need to be at weekend Events when required)

Key Responsibilities
  • Own day‑to‑day event operations across multiple immersive shows
  • Lead operational planning from confirmation through to post‑show wrap
  • Manage weekend show teams, ensuring they are trained, confident and aligned
  • Troubleshoot calmly and professionally in real time during live delivery
  • Ensure outstanding customer service and guest experience standards
  • Coordinate logistics, schedules, staffing, equipment, stock and consumables
  • Maintain strong communication with internal teams and venue partners
  • Ensure compliance with venue rules, local regulations and safety standards
  • Conduct post‑show debriefs and support continuous improvement
